1. A computer system comprising:

  • a main computer system comprising a database, an application server and a front-end server, wherein the main system executes an application in cooperation with a human user; and

    a remote service computer system for evaluating problems in the main system, comprising;

    a service module to collect problem related data from the main system, said problem related data representing a problem identified about data in the main system;

    an acquisition module to acquire knowledge representations;

    a knowledge module to receive the knowledge representations, generate solution identification rules comprising computer instructions to automatically solve the problem, group sets of the solution identification rules semantically, and store the knowledge representations with the sets of semantically grouped solution identification rules; and

    an inference module to process problem related data with knowledge representations to identify the solution identification rules and forward the solution identification rules through the service module to the main computer system, wherein the inference module identifies the solution identification rules by applying knowledge representations to the problem related data in at least one of a sequential order, a hierarchical order, and a dynamically adaptive order and wherein the identified solution identification rules are applied to solve the problem identified in the main system.
